From 115aa6dbd2c7c06bfcb438210409be5bafba5e6c Mon Sep 17 00:00:00 2001 From: dongzl Date: Tue, 1 Sep 2020 09:28:30 +0800 Subject: [PATCH] sqlserver sql parser, insert support top keyword. --- .../src/main/antlr4/imports/sqlserver/DMLStatement.g4 |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/shardingsphere-sql-parser/shardingsphere-sql-parser-dialect/shardingsphere-sql-parser-sqlserver/src/main/antlr4/imports/sqlserver/DMLStatement.g4 b/shardingsphere-sql-parser/shardingsphere-sql-parser-dialect/shardingsphere-sql-parser-sqlserver/src/main/antlr4/imports/sqlserver/DMLStatement.g4 index e9b47a1363..08c80c303a 100644 --- a/shardingsphere-sql-parser/shardingsphere-sql-parser-dialect/shardingsphere-sql-parser-sqlserver/src/main/antlr4/imports/sqlserver/DMLStatement.g4 +++ b/shardingsphere-sql-parser/shardingsphere-sql-parser-dialect/shardingsphere-sql-parser-sqlserver/src/main/antlr4/imports/sqlserver/DMLStatement.g4 @@ -20,7 +20,7 @@ grammar DMLStatement; import Symbol, Keyword, SQLServerKeyword, Literals, BaseRule; insert - : withClause_? INSERT INTO? tableName (AS? alias)? (insertDefaultValue | insertValuesClause | insertSelectClause) + : withClause_? INSERT top? INTO? tableName (AS? alias)? (insertDefaultValue | insertValuesClause | insertSelectClause) ; insertDefaultValue -- GitLab